The number of air freight and mail arrivals in Egypt has shown variability over the past decade, experiencing growth, dips, and recovery. As of 2023, the value stands at 121.2 thousand units. Throughout the years, significant variations emerged, notably a stark decrease in 2020 followed by robust recovery in subsequent years. The five-year CAGR leading up to 2023 is approximately 0.99%. Looking ahead, the forecast suggests a steady but modest growth rate, with a five-year CAGR of 0.76% and a total forecasted growth rate of 3.86% by 2028.
